As of August 2016, California has about 6,000 state prisoners in two privately operated correctional centers in Arizona and Mississippi to relieve prison overcrowding: the La Palma Correctional Facility, and the Tallahatchie County Correctional Facility. read more

California's prisons are public and are financed by the Public Works Department and operated by the California Department of Corrections and Rehabilitation. In 2015, California had a prison population of 129,593, which was lower than the peak prison population of 173,942 in 2006. read more
